He may be out of office, but he’s still driving people crazy.
Former President Joe Biden has been overheard asking for frozen treats while commuting on Amtrak to his government-provided DC office — where little known work is being done — as well as allegedly forgetting a top rule of the train.
“He was talking in the quiet car!” a disbelieving Amtrak regular vented to The Post.
The 82-year-old former chief executive, who rode the route back and forth to Delaware during his 36 years in the Senate, also has gotten rusty on the cafe car’s offerings.
Biden recently asked for ice cream — his favorite snack — but had to settle for a muffin.
Amtrak’s “quiet car” is the second on the Acela — behind first class — and its code of conduct is enforced by conductors and passengers who brusquely hiss “shhhhhh!” at violators.
A second witness who has seen Biden chatting in the quiet car argued it wasn’t his fault.
“If he’s talking, it’s because he’s constantly approached,” said this person, noting that whispered exchanges are allowed.
“[That] is always a criticism of him — that he’s too soft spoken! No winning.”
The ex-president’s travels have been captured in a stream of photos from fellow riders — and even a brief May 8 interview...
**SNIP**
Several alums of the Biden White House say there’s intrigue into what exactly he is doing most weeks at his temporary office a short distance from DC’s Union Station.
The General Services Administration pays for the office until July, meaning Biden will have to relocate soon if he intends to continue commuting to the capital.
“It’s really a mystery,” one former Biden aide said of his activities while visiting DC, noting that staff still working for Biden “avoid answering.”

I grew up in the 50’s in Rochester, NY. My Dad worked for NY Central Railroad as a Track Foreman, so he had a family pass for us all to ride the train for free. It was a real treat for us kids, because we didn’t have a car. Back then they had dining cars on all the trains, and they also had porters come around with sandwiches and drinks during the ride. My mother used to pack sandwiches for everyone, and brought along an insulated bottle that she’d put Kool-aid in. For a small kid, it was the cat’s meow. My father retired not long after the company became Penn Central. The Acela Train doesn’t come anywhere near where I live. About four years ago, I thought about taking the train from Rome, NY where I live to visit my youngest son in Indianapolis, Indiana. I called Amtrak to see if it was a possibility, but they said I’d have to go to NY City or Washington first, in order to get a train that headed out that way.
